Overview
The shell of this series of resistance furnace is welded by a good Cold rolled steel plate, and the furnace door adopts a side open structure, which is flexible to open. The internal thermal insulation material is 0.4-0 lightweight thermal insulation brick and aluminum silicate fiber cotton, so that the heat storage and Thermal conductivity are reduced, resulting in large heat storage in the studio, short Heating time, low temperature rise on the Instrument surface, and greatly reduced power and Power consumption of the empty furnace. This series of resistance furnaces can be used for elemental analysis and determination in laboratories, industrial and mining enterprises, R & D institutions, etc., heating for small steel parts and other metals during heat treatment, equipped with temperature controller and Thermocouple for temperature measurement, which is supplied by our company in a complete set.

Principle
The resistance furnace works by converting electrical energy into heat energy. Heat is generated when the heating element is energized. The high-temperature refractory materials in the furnace and the external good thermal insulation structure (such as lightweight thermal insulation bricks and aluminum silicate fiber cotton) can effectively reduce heat loss, ensuring that the temperature in the furnace rises quickly and evenly and stabilizes at the set value. The matching intelligent PID temperature controller works in conjunction with Thermocouple to accurately measure and control the temperature in the furnace.
